Output fbae904a07d7bc1679ef822a19609cd96b3622babb2b5cfbd33cf29135247acc:11

value
18920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4e18ba4c54790d80f30a13d61804aa9c0dabb50 OP_EQUAL
address
3M6dNPP5xykxhTJdxLfoRdcdM4242Z78EL
transaction
fbae904a07d7bc1679ef822a19609cd96b3622babb2b5cfbd33cf29135247acc
confirmations
319183
spent
true